  • Abide - definition of abide by The Free Dictionary
    1 to remain; stay: Abide with me 2 to have one's abode; dwell; reside 3 to continue in a particular condition; last; endure 4 to put up with; tolerate; stand: I can't abide dishonesty! 5 to endure or withstand without yielding: to abide a vigorous onslaught 6 to wait for; await: to abide the coming of the Lord
  • Abide - Definition, Meaning Synonyms - Vocabulary. com
    Abide means "to be able to live with or put up with " If you can't abide with something, it means you can't stand it If you can abide it, it means you can live with it An old definition of abide is "to live" — think of abode, as in "dwelling " If you abide by the rules, it means you live with them, and you will follow them
